We just completed our first Continental Math League competition last Thursday, you may have heard some of your kids talk about it. What it is, is an enrichment opportunity for those mathematicians that can use their logic and problem solving skills to compete against kids from all over!
We compete the first Thursday of the month. The kids answer the questions here in class, I correct and send our scores off to be evaluated and compared. The results are then tabulated and shared with us about 2 weeks later (I will post as soon as I get them!) It was kind of a last minute decision to begin the competition, we were waiting for funding, but now that we know we are going to be, we will be practicing logic type word problem skills in class to prepare for the next meet!
